Job Title: Complex Claims Lead Attorney
Job Summary
The Complex Claims Lead Attorney will help administer product-defect, anti-trust, medical, consumer law and other types of class action settlement claims. This is not a document review position.
Essential Job Functions
Analyzing claim documents in compliance with settlement guidelines and internal documentation/processing procedures.
Documenting claims analyses using a combination of proprietary and commercial business software for internal record-keeping and possible further review
Drafting and reviewing detailed analyses and responses to complex written inquiries and data sets by claimants or third-party filers.
Fielding complex telephone and email inquiries from claimants or third-party filers, occasionally regarding sensitive and/or confidential subject matter
Receiving training, direction, and oversight from lead attorneys, supervisors, and other project team members.
Collaborating with other attorneys, lead attorneys, and supervisors on group projects and undertaking self-directed individual projects.
